Cardiac Valve Allografts II: Science and Practice
Introduction Since the supply of homograft heart valves is limited and since in
most institutions homograft valves are not immediately implanted after
procurement, storage of heart valves has therefore become essential. At present,
centers ...

Homograft. aortic. replacement. Aortic homograft (also known as allograft), can
be inserted in the same way as a Freestyle prosthesis as a subcoronary aortic
valve replacement (LEI p384), as an inclusion cylinder (fill p387), or as a root ...
